T&T Doctors join protest

Published:Tuesday | March 22, 2011 | 11:19 AM

Doctors at a hospital have joined workers in a demonstration over a probe into the circumstances that led to the death of a 29-year-old woman earlier this month.



Chrystal Boodoo-Ramsoomair died following an emergency Caesarean section at the San Fernando Hospital but her baby survived.



The doctors, who over the weekend passed a resolution calling for the removal of Health Minister, Therese Baptiste-Cornelis, said the protest is also to condemn the suspension of five doctors and four nurses as a result of the incident.



They have pledged not to cooperate with an investigation.
